可以注册域名,但是没有出现在搜索引擎上吗?


0

我需要创建一个个人网站,但我不希望它出现在Google或其他搜索引擎中。我只希望特定的人可以使用它。

例如:如果我购买www.example.com,我希望这些网页仅对那些在其浏览器的URL栏中输入该地址的用户可用。不在搜索引擎中。那可能吗?

编辑:我知道关于robots.txt。但这是针对页面的,而不是我要寻找的内容。我正在寻找整个域名,只有知道它的人才能使用。

dns 

您可以使用知道您的域的人知道的密码来做一个简单的htaccess文件。这样至少可以防止“外部人员”通过搜索访问您的网站。
kobaltz 2014年

Answers:


0

否。注册域名时,这是公共知识。保守秘密是不可能的。当它出现在搜索引擎看到的任何内容中时,[facebook帖子,twitter消息,任何内容]都将被“编入索引”。所有你能做的,通过robots.txt,是搜索网站无法抓取您的网站,但得到了他们的名字,仍然会有索引。(据记录,许多抓取工具会忽略您中的所有内容robots.txt


1

严格正确的答案是“否”,但是,您可以通过其中的一种方式(除了不鼓励使用robots.txt的机器人)来使网络服务器查找REFERER字符串,并且将“ Referer”作为搜索引擎(或未经授权的网站)。

这样做取决于您的服务器-如果您使用的是Apache,则应该能够使用mod_rewrite来匹配REFERER变量(拼写正确-这是标准错误)。虽然没有什么可以阻止某人颠覆这一点,但是它应该可以捕获很多自动化站点。

另一个解决方案可能是限制朋友访问服务器-例如,通过限制他们的IP地址(或使用VPN),甚至确保他们使用特定的,晦涩的浏览器并进行检查。

不过,考虑一下,最好的方法可能就是使用.htaccess密码保护整个站点,并为您的朋友提供登录凭据!

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.